Ingredients

To bring this lovely Cranberry Pineapple Punch Mocktail to life, gather the following ingredients:

  • 4 ounces Sparkling Ice® Cranberry Frost (or Sparkling Cranberry Juice)
    This bubbly beverage packs a punch of cranberry flavor with a refreshing fizz. If you can’t find it, opt for sparkling cranberry juice to maintain that effervescent quality.

  • 2 ounces Pineapple Juice
    Sweet and tangy, pineapple juice adds a tropical flair to the punch. If you want a more natural option, consider fresh pineapple juice, which can elevate the flavor even more.

  • 2 ounces Sprite
    This classic lemon-lime soda adds the perfect touch of sweetness and carbonation. For a healthier alternative, use a diet soda or sparkling water for a less sugary sip.

  • Ice
    Perfect for chilling your punch and keeping it refreshing! Use crushed ice for a fun twist or standard ice cubes—whichever you prefer works beautifully.

  • Frozen or Fresh Cranberries for Garnish (optional)
    Adding cranberries not only enhances the drink’s festive visual appeal, but they also float elegantly in the glass. They’re a fun and approachable garnish that guests will love!

Step-by-Step Instructions

Ready to shake up some magic in the kitchen? Let’s get right into those easy, breezy steps!

  1. Prep Your Ingredients:
    Before diving in, gather all your ingredients. This is the moment to appreciate the colors—deep reds and bright yellows make this drink so inviting!

  2. Chill Your Glasses:
    Before you start mixing, pop your glasses in the freezer for about 10 minutes. A chilled glass makes all the difference in keeping your drink refreshing.

  3. Combine Sparkling Ice and Pineapple Juice:
    In a mixing pitcher, pour in the 4 ounces of Sparkling Ice Cranberry Frost. Then, add 2 ounces of pineapple juice. Gently stir with a spoon to combine. The vibrant colors will start blending beautifully!

  4. Add Sprite:
    Next, pour in the 2 ounces of Sprite! This is where the magic happens—watch those bubbles rise and dance. Give it a delicate stir, taking care not to lose too much fizz.

  5. Ice, Ice Baby:
    Grab those chilled glasses and fill them with ice. You can use crushed ice for a fun texture or standard cubes for a classic touch.

  6. Pour the Punch:
    Carefully pour your punch mixture over the ice in each glass. Aim to fill each about three-quarters full. The colorful blend should look like a mini sunset in your glass—how pretty!

  7. Garnish Like a Pro:
    If you’re feeling fancy, drop in a few frozen or fresh cranberries for that eye-catching detail. You can also add a slice of pineapple on the rim for an extra festive touch.

  8. Serve and Enjoy:
    Now that you’ve crafted a stunning mocktail, it’s time to serve! Gather your guests, raise your glasses, and toast to great flavors and wonderful company.

Recipe Variations

Now, let’s get adventurous! Here are some creative twists and variations to take your mocktail game to the next level:

  • Cranberry Lime Refresh: Swap out the pineapple juice for fresh lime juice. This will add a zesty kick to your punch!

  • Berry Blast: Add a handful of muddled fresh berries (think strawberries and blueberries) before pouring the mocktail. They’ll burst with flavor and add a lovely color gradient.

  • Herbal Infusion: Infuse your punch with a few crushed basil or mint leaves for a refreshing twist.

  • Coconut Bliss: Substitute half of the pineapple juice with coconut water for a tropical vibe that will transport you to your favorite beach.

  • Sparkling Citrus Delight: Instead of Sprite, use lemonade or a lemon-lime sparkling beverage to give it an extra citrus pop.

FAQs and Troubleshooting

  1. Why is my punch not fizzy?
    If your punch has lost its fizz, it could be that the ingredients were stirred too vigorously. Make sure to mix gently after adding the carbonation.

  2. Can I make it ahead of time?
    While you can prepare the juice mixture in advance, I recommend adding the soda and ice just before serving to retain that sparkling freshness.

  3. What if I want a more intense flavor?
    If you’re craving a stronger flavor, try increasing the amounts of cranberry juice and pineapple juice to suit your taste. Just be careful with the sweetness balance!

  4. How can I make this mocktail a cocktail?
    Feel free to add your favorite spirit! Vodka or gin can pair wonderfully without overwhelming the flavors. Start with a shot (1.5 ounces) and adjust to your preference.
